Proteomic analysis of the earthworm Eisenia fetida exposed to oxytetracycline in soil

Increasing attention has been paid to the toxicity and hazards of antibiotics on non-target organisms in soil ecosystems as excess antibiotics in the excretion of treated animals are being brought into the soil through manure and sewage irrigation.
